Spitz is a big unknown...
Even to Packer fans. Prior to his back injury, he was a guy who just showed up and did his job. Not much fanfare about him. Spitz is very versatile and can play any of the 3 interior OL positions. Best at Center, than RG and lastly at LG. That is a strength. Really he’s not overly talented, but is tough and smart. A typical OL in that regard. If he can play Center, he’ll become a really good one in a year. Assuming his back is in good shape, he is the kind of OL that can help any team.

I'm surprised he was signed so quickly
He wasn’t able to beat out Daryn Colledge or Scott Wells for a starting spot on the line, and he wasn’t even able to start a competition. He was a fine right guard for a couple seasons, and looked like the center of the future, so maybe the back issues really had been a problem. If he’s over them, the Jaguars probably have an average offensive guard. Still, that doesn’t make him a priority free agent signing.
